| ln Vitro |
GLPG-0492 is a novel and potent androgen receptor modulator with anabolic activity on muscle. It is a non-steroidal selective androgen receptor modulator (SARM) that can reduce muscle loss while sparing reproductive tissues. GLPG-0492 treatment partially prevents immobilization-induced muscle atrophy and has a tendency to promote muscle fiber hypertrophy in a dose-dependent manner. Specific EC50 values for androgen receptor activation and selectivity data are available from preclinical studies. The compound has the potential to be used for muscle atrophy and possibly for Duchenne muscular dystrophy.

| ln Vivo |
In vivo, GLPG-0492 has been shown to partially prevent immobilization-induced muscle atrophy and to promote muscle fiber hypertrophy in a dose-dependent manner. The compound has anabolic activity on muscle and can reduce muscle loss while sparing reproductive tissues. Specific dosing regimens and detailed efficacy data are available from preclinical studies. GLPG-0492 has been investigated for the treatment of muscle wasting disorders, including Duchenne muscular dystrophy.

| Enzyme Assay |
Androgen receptor binding affinity is assessed using in vitro radioligand binding assays with recombinant androgen receptor. Competitive binding with [3H]testosterone or other selective ligands is measured. Androgen receptor activity is assessed using reporter gene assays in cells transfected with androgen receptor and a luciferase reporter. EC50 values are calculated from dose-response curves. Selectivity is evaluated by testing against other nuclear receptors.

| Cell Assay |
Cellular activity is evaluated in muscle cells (e.g., C2C12 myotubes). Cells are treated with GLPG-0492 at various concentrations (typically 0.001-100 µM) for appropriate time periods. Androgen receptor target gene expression (e.g., myostatin, IGF-1) is measured by qRT-PCR. Protein synthesis is measured by assessing the incorporation of radiolabeled amino acids. Myotube diameter is measured to assess hypertrophy. Selectivity for muscle over reproductive tissues is assessed in relevant cell models.

| Animal Protocol |
In vivo efficacy is studied in animal models of muscle atrophy, such as immobilization-induced atrophy, denervation-induced atrophy, or cachexia models. GLPG-0492 is administered orally at various doses. Muscle mass (e.g., gastrocnemius, tibialis anterior) is measured. Muscle fiber cross-sectional area is measured histologically. Muscle strength is assessed by grip strength or other functional tests. Reproductive tissue weight (e.g., prostate, seminal vesicles) is measured to assess selectivity.

| Additional Infomation |
Glpg0492 is being studied in the clinical trial NCT01130818 (first-in-human single-increment dose of GLPG0492).
GLPG-0492 is a research tool compound and clinical candidate for studying androgen receptor biology and muscle wasting disorders. It is not approved for clinical use. The compound is a non-steroidal selective androgen receptor modulator (SARM) with anabolic activity on muscle. GLPG-0492 has been investigated for the treatment of muscle atrophy, Duchenne muscular dystrophy, and other conditions involving muscle wasting. Its tissue selectivity for muscle over reproductive tissues makes it a valuable tool for understanding the molecular basis of androgen receptor signaling and for developing therapies that promote muscle growth without undesirable androgenic side effects. |

| Solubility (In Vivo) |
Solubility in Formulation 1: ≥ 2.5 mg/mL (6.42 mM) (saturation unknown) in 10% DMSO + 40% PEG300 + 5% Tween80 + 45% Saline (add these co-solvents sequentially from left to right, and one by one), clear solution.
For example, if 1 mL of working solution is to be prepared, you can add 100 μL of 25.0 mg/mL clear DMSO stock solution to 400 μL PEG300 and mix evenly; then add 50 μL Tween-80 to the above solution and mix evenly; then add 450 μL normal saline to adjust the volume to 1 mL. Preparation of saline: Dissolve 0.9 g of sodium chloride in 100 mL ddH₂ O to obtain a clear solution. Solubility in Formulation 2: ≥ 2.5 mg/mL (6.42 mM) (saturation unknown) in 10% DMSO + 90% (20% SBE-β-CD in Saline) (add these co-solvents sequentially from left to right, and one by one), clear solution. For example, if 1 mL of working solution is to be prepared, you can add 100 μL of 25.0 mg/mL clear DMSO stock solution to 900 μL of 20% SBE-β-CD physiological saline solution and mix evenly. Preparation of 20% SBE-β-CD in Saline (4°C,1 week): Dissolve 2 g SBE-β-CD in 10 mL saline to obtain a clear solution. View More
Solubility in Formulation 3: ≥ 2.5 mg/mL (6.42 mM) (saturation unknown) in 10% DMSO + 90% Corn Oil (add these co-solvents sequentially from left to right, and one by one), clear solution. |
